All registered nurses and midwives in South Africa are required to pay their SANC annual registration fees to the South African Nursing Council (SANC) by the due date each year. This payment is crucial for maintaining your license to practice and staying compliant with national healthcare regulations.

Once your fee is paid, SANC issues your Annual Practising Certificate (APC), a legal document that confirms your eligibility to work as a nurse or midwife in South Africa for the year. Without a valid APC, you are not legally permitted to practice.

How much are the annual SANC 2026 fees?

Please refer to the SANC website for more information.

Category Annual fees for 2026
Registered Nurses and Midwives R870.00
Enrolled Nurses and Midwives R520.00
Enrolled Nursing Auxiliaries R370.00

Annual reductions for those aged 60 to 64 years on 1 January 2026 (25% reduction)

Category Annual fees for 2026
Registered Nurses and Midwives R660.00
Enrolled Nurses and Midwives R390.00
Enrolled Nursing Auxiliaries R280.00

Those who turn 65 on 1 January 2026 (50% reduction)

Category Annual fees for 2026
Registered Nurses and Midwives R440.00
Enrolled Nurses and Midwives R260.00
Enrolled Nursing Auxiliaries R180.00

Notes

  • The SANC must collect the 2026 annual fees by 31 December 2025.

  • All the amounts shown in the above tables include 15% VAT.

2026 Restoration Fees

This table lists the restoration fees for each category that will be in effect on January 1, 2026.

Category Annual fees for 2026 Reduced Restoration Fee
Registered Nurses and Midwives R 2 610.00 R 180.00
Enrolled Nurses and Midwives R1 560.00 R 180.00
Enrolled Nursing Auxiliaries R1 110.00 R 180.00
Retired Nurse R180.00 R180.00
